Workforced
Workforced is a humor blog written by, shall we say, a somewhat disgruntled employee. He’s not really disgruntled about his job in particular, but more about office life and the corporate machine in general. I’m not sure what Don Joe does for a real living, but he should be writing instead.
Workforced– Why You Should Go
It’s hilarious. If you’ve ever worked in an office environment; you’ll get it. Don Joe never fails to catch the absurdity and lost sense of logic that prevails in corporate America. I write a lot of website reviews, and this is the first time I’ve actually laughed out loud. The writing is witty, sarcastic and right on target. The illustrations are fantastic. You’ll add it to your weekly reads. And, I’m not the only one who loves it; Don Joe is quite highly acclaimed.
Summing Up Workforced
Funny, funny, funny blog about working in corporate America. The blog is also quite well done from a layout perspective. It’s pleasing to the eyes.
